What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Atlanta to Guinea?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Atlanta to Guinea cl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

If you are looking for a flight deal from Atlanta to Guinea, look for departures on Tuesdays and avoid leaving on a Monday, as it's usually the priciest day. When flying back from Guinea, Thursday is the cheapest day to fly and Tuesday is the most expensive.

  • What is the cheapest time of day to fly to Guinea?

    The cheapest time of day to fly to Guinea is generally in the morning, when round-trip flights cost $1,567 on average. Morning departures are around 4% cheaper than evening flights, on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to Guinea is generally at night,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is $1,804.
